(Chicago, IL) — Anthony Rizzo’s RBI double capped a three-run bottom of the eighth as the Cubs rallied to beat the Cardinals 3-2 at Wrigley Field. Ben Zobrist had an RBI double and Kris Bryant tied the game for Chicago with a run-scoring single. Paul DeJong and Randal Grichuk hit back-to-back home runs in the top of the inning to stake St. Louis to a 2-0 lead. Jon Lester struck out 10 over eight innings of three-hit, two-run ball to move to 7-and-6. Wade Davis notched his 19th save. Matt Bowman took the loss. The Cardinals have dropped three-of-four.
